What is Wheel Offset? The Foundation of Fitment
Wheel offset is the distance between the mounting surface of the wheel (where it bolts to the hub) and the centerline of the wheel. This seemingly simple measurement dictates how far a wheel sits inward or outward from the hub. It’s typically measured in millimeters (mm), and it’s the single most important factor in determining wheel fitment. A positive offset means the mounting surface is closer to the outside of the wheel, pushing it inward. Conversely, a negative offset means the mounting surface is closer to the inside of the wheel, pushing it outward. Zero offset means the mounting surface is exactly in the center of the wheel.
Think of it like this: if you were to draw a line down the exact middle of your wheel, offset measures the distance from that line to where the wheel actually attaches to your car’s hub. A positive offset will push the wheel further into the fender well, while a negative offset will push it out towards the fender lip. This has direct implications for how much space you have between your tire and the fender, as well as the suspension components on the inside. Incorrect offset can lead to rubbing, premature tire wear, and even damage to your fenders or suspension.
Decoding Positive, Negative, and Zero Offset

Let’s break down the three main types of offset. **Positive offset** is the most common for front-wheel-drive vehicles and many modern SUVs. For example, a +35mm offset means the mounting surface is 35mm further out from the wheel’s centerline. This typically results in the wheel sitting further inside the fender well. A wheel with a +50mm offset will sit even further inward than a +35mm offset. This is often used to ensure clearance with brake components or to maintain a more tucked-in look.
**Negative offset** is more prevalent on rear-wheel-drive performance cars and trucks, especially those with wider wheelbases or when aiming for an aggressive, “stanced” look. A -10mm offset means the mounting surface is 10mm closer to the *outside* of the wheel than its centerline, pushing the wheel outward. A more extreme negative offset, like -25mm, will push the wheel out even further, potentially beyond the fender line. This can improve handling by widening the track width but requires careful consideration for fender clearance and potential rubbing.
**Zero offset** (0mm) means the mounting surface is perfectly aligned with the wheel’s centerline. This is less common but can be found on some specific vehicle applications. When a wheel has a zero offset, its inner and outer faces are equidistant from the hub mounting plane. This can be a good starting point for custom builds, but still requires careful calculation to ensure proper fitment.

How Offset Impacts Stance and Clearance

The offset of your wheels dramatically influences your vehicle’s **stance**, which is the overall visual appearance of its ride height and wheel positioning. A positive offset generally tucks the wheel into the fender, creating a more subtle and often stock-like appearance. For example, many factory wheels have offsets in the +35mm to +50mm range. Using wheels with a slightly lower positive offset, say +25mm, can bring the wheel out a bit closer to the fender, giving a more aggressive, planted look without excessive protrusion.
On the other hand, negative offsets push the wheel outward, creating a wider, more muscular stance. This is commonly seen on lifted trucks or performance cars aiming for an aggressive track-inspired look. For example, a -12mm offset on a truck can make the wheels sit flush or even slightly proud of the fender flares, enhancing its imposing presence. However, excessively negative offsets can lead to tires rubbing on the fenders during turns or over bumps, requiring fender modifications or adjustments to suspension geometry. It’s a balancing act between aesthetics and practicality, and the right offset is key to achieving your desired look without compromising functionality.
